From the latest viral trends to reliable everyday basics, we are your one-stop shop for everything you need. We aim to simplify your shopping journey by filtering out the noise and presenting only the best options available.
Car Stereo Radio Panel ABS Plastic Frame Panel 2 DIN Mount For 7 Inch Large Screen Car Radio Installation Trim Panel DVD Player Check full details on AliExpress.